Pushing Limits: Tandem Press Brakes for Long Sheet Metal Bending
When it comes to bending large sheets of metal, conventional press brakes often reach their capacity. This is where tandem press brakes stand out, offering a reliable solution for accomplishing intricate bends on extended lengths. Tandem systems utilize multiple press brake units connected in a line, allowing them to work with sheet metal that surpasses the capabilities of single-station machines.
By leveraging this synchronized bending process, tandem systems provide exceptional accuracy. This is significantly important for projects requiring complex geometries or precise bend profiles.
